What Is a Raised Face Weld Neck Flange?

A Raised Face Weld Neck Flange (RF WN Flange) is a high-strength forged pipe flange designed for high-pressure and high-temperature piping systems. It features a long tapered hub that is butt-welded directly to the pipe, providing smooth stress distribution between the flange and pipe while improving fatigue resistance and structural integrity.

The raised face (RF) provides an elevated gasket seating surface that concentrates bolt load over the gasket area to create a reliable pressure-tight connection. Due to its robust design, Raised Face Weld Neck Flanges are widely used in critical service applications, including oil & gas, petrochemical, chemical processing, and power generation systems.

Design & Construction of Raised Face Weld Neck Flanges

The Raised Face Weld Neck Flange (RF WN Flange) is engineered for high-pressure and high-temperature piping systems, combining a long tapered hub, precision-machined raised face, and robust forged construction. The tapered hub provides a gradual transition between the flange and pipe, helping distribute loads and reduce stress concentration at the connection.

The raised face gasket seating surface is precision machined to provide the required surface finish for reliable gasket sealing when properly assembled. Manufactured through a controlled forging process, the flange offers excellent mechanical strength and durability. Heat treatment, when specified, helps achieve the required material properties, while CNC machining ensures accurate dimensions, bore alignment, bolt hole positioning, and surface finish.

Weld Neck Flange Specifications

Dimensional Standards

Pressure Ratings

Standard Pressure Rating
ASME B16.5 / B16.47 Class 75 – 2500
API 6B / 6BX 2000 PSI – 20000 PSI
DIN / EN PN 6 – PN160
JIS B2220 5K – 30K

Forming Methods

Open Die Forging

Shaped between flat or contoured dies — ideal for large-diameter flanges, giving excellent grain flow and strength.

Closed Die Forging

Metal forced into a two-piece die cavity, producing precise, tight-tolerance flanges with minimal machining.

Roll Forging

Billet progressively shaped by rotating rollers, giving a uniform grain structure and high fatigue resistance.

Casting

Molten metal poured into a mould — a cost-effective process for complex geometries.
